The Nostalgic Return of Backyard Sports: A New Adventure Awaits
In an exciting development for both nostalgic fans and new players, the beloved video game franchise ‘Backyard Sports’ is making a grand re-entry into the gaming world. Originally launched in the late 1990s and early 2000s, this iconic se...